Peeking under the hood at the contract, CHEWY looks like an ERC-20 token with some extra tricks. It seems to have a tax mechanism – you know, those buy and sell taxes that can change based on trading activity. It also includes functions for swapping tokens and adding liquidity to decentralized exchanges (DEXs). On the security front, it has features to prevent massive sell-offs in a single block, which is good for stability, in theory. Interestingly, it's an Ownable contract, meaning there's an owner who can tweak things like transfer limits. Transparency is key, and while some info is available, the contract source isn’t verified everywhere, which raises a slight eyebrow. 🤔

Now for the not-so-fun part: risks. Meme tokens are inherently risky. Volatility? Off the charts. Utility? Often questionable. Rug pulls? Sadly, a real concern. And with CHEWY, we've got those scam warnings floating around. Plus, the low liquidity pool (one report mentioned only $4 😬) is definitely something to watch out for. A tiny liquidity pool means bigger price swings and potential difficulty buying or selling when you want to.
